BERLIN, July 24, 2015 /PRNewswire/ -- The organizers
of the BMW BERLIN-MARATHON today
proudly announced a new partnership with the global healthcare
company Abbott (NYSE: ABT), which became an Official Sponsor
of the 2015 BMW BERLIN-MARATHON,
one of six iconic races in the Abbott World Marathon Majors
series.
With more than 2,500 employees in Germany at seven locations nationwide, Abbott
is devoted to developing products and technologies that improve
health and make life better. Through its sponsorship of the 2015
BMW BERLIN-MARATHON, Abbott will
celebrate how people can do more, achieve more and experience more
through their best health.
Abbott's sponsorship will come to life in a number of ways. For
the 40,000 registered participants – including more than 30 Abbott
employees from around the world – the company will have a "Cheer
Zone" at the 38 kilometer point of the course, providing a welcome
boost as runners push through to the finish line. Nearly 100 Abbott
employees from its Wiesbaden location will show up to encourage
athletes to achieve their race-day goals.
As title sponsor of the Abbott World Marathon Majors, Abbott is
encouraging the sharing of health "best practices" among the six
races in the series. At the 2015 BMW BERLIN-MARATHON, Abbott will provide portable
blood analysis systems called the i-STAT®, which perform commonly
ordered blood tests – such as those for checking heart function or
monitoring physical exertion – within minutes and empowers the
Marathon medical staff to administer care onsite.

About BMW BERLIN-MARATHON
A group of runners from one of Germany's most prestigious athletics clubs, SC
Charlottenburg, organized the first BERLIN-MARATHON in 1974. It was not until 1981
that the race moved from the Grunewald (a big forest area) into the
city center of West Berlin. It was after the Berlin Wall collapsed
in November 1989 when a new era
started. On September 30, 1990, three
days before reunification, the course of the BERLIN-MARATHON led through Brandenburg Gate
and both parts of Berlin. The BMW
BERLIN-MARATHON has developed into
one of the world's best quality road races and as an inherent part
of the Abbott World Marathon Majors. Last year's 2:02:57 by the
Kenyan Dennis Kimetto was the tenth world record on a course which
makes full use of Berlin's flat
terrain and gentle corners.
